Home » Developer & Programmer » Reports & Discoverer » setting vertical elasticity overlapping on lines below it (Oracle Reports 6i)
setting vertical elasticity overlapping on lines below it [message #664367] Wed, 12 July 2017 15:13 Go to next message
rkhatiwala
Messages: 178
Registered: April 2007
Senior Member
Hello,

I have a report which has 2 pages.There is a repeating frame on page 1 which was originally set for 6 rows. Now it can have upto 25 rows, or sometimes even 0 rows. Modified my query for that repeating frame to get max of 25 rows. Set the 'Max Records per page' for the repeating frame to 25, set the Vertical Elasticity of the repeating frame to Expand/variable. But still the rows are overlapping on the text beneath the repeating frame. The lines below should move down, so the 1st page of the report consists of 2 pages, and the 2nd page is unaffected, becomes 3rd page.

Please advise on how to add the vertical elasticity to this repeating frame, and not mess up the layout?

Thanks
Re: setting vertical elasticity overlapping on lines below it [message #664368 is a reply to message #664367] Thu, 13 July 2017 01:01 Go to previous messageGo to next message
Littlefoot
Messages: 21806
Registered: June 2005
Location: Croatia, Europe
Senior Member
Account Moderator
Try to put fields (i.e. "the text beneath the repeating frame") into its own frame.
Re: setting vertical elasticity overlapping on lines below it [message #664380 is a reply to message #664368] Fri, 14 July 2017 08:40 Go to previous messageGo to next message
rkhatiwala
Messages: 178
Registered: April 2007
Senior Member
Thanks. Putting the standard frame around the objects below the repeating frame, and anchoring these, worked fine, but now the objects in the standard frames are not staying in the frame, and overlapping on the repeating frame.i also increased the height in 'Parameter Form Window' of the report property.

Thanks again.
Re: setting vertical elasticity overlapping on lines below it [message #664382 is a reply to message #664380] Fri, 14 July 2017 15:53 Go to previous messageGo to next message
rkhatiwala
Messages: 178
Registered: April 2007
Senior Member
I have one main repeating frame R1.
Under that two frames M1, M2.
M1 has one repeating frame RG.

All of these has 'Vertical Elasticity' as variable. so if RG has more rows, should not the outer frames - M1, R1 be expanded by itself,and M2 pushed down?

thanks.
Re: setting vertical elasticity overlapping on lines below it [message #664409 is a reply to message #664382] Sat, 15 July 2017 08:20 Go to previous message
Littlefoot
Messages: 21806
Registered: June 2005
Location: Croatia, Europe
Senior Member
Account Moderator
Yes, they should (at least, I'd expect them to be).

If frames' border lines are set so that they "touch" each other, try to move them apart, so that you can clearly see each frame by itself (i.e. so that they don't "touch" each other). In order to see it clearly, paint them into different colors. Doesn't matter if the report looks like a parrot, as long as it helps distinguishing one frame from another. You'd clear those colors once/if you make the report work as expected. Sometimes Reports behaves strange, and pushing a frame "down" just a little bit improves the final, runtime layout.
Previous Topic: Make a field height as the one in the report
Next Topic: Join, one item with many
Goto Forum:
  


Current Time: Fri Mar 29 03:01:14 CDT 2024